Our Safe And Compliant Well Abandonment

Residential Well Abandonment

You might have connected to a public water supply or drilled a new well, but your old residential well needs to be safely abandoned. Our team will seal your well according to local and state guidelines, ensuring the site is left in a safe condition.

Commercial Well Abandonment

Our commercial well abandonment service ensures a hassle-free process for businesses that no longer need their wells. We adhere to strict guidelines and use advanced tools to seal off commercial wells, preventing any environmental impact or safety hazards.

Agricultural Well Abandonment

If your farm is moving away from well water or an old well poses a threat, our agricultural well abandonment service is the solution. We'll work diligently to safely decommission your well and minimize any potential impacts on your farmland.

Emergency Well Abandonment

Sometimes, immediate well abandonment may be necessary due to safety risks. Our emergency well abandonment services are designed to respond swiftly in such situations, providing safe and compliant well-sealing solutions when needed.

Monitoring Well Abandonment

Monitoring wells used for environmental or geological studies may need to be abandoned once their purpose has been fulfilled. We provide a thorough and professional service for monitoring well abandonment, ensuring they're adequately sealed to prevent any future contamination.
